Electric Circuit Description

7.5.1
Scan motor control circuit
The scan motor is a stepping motor driven by the control signal output from the scanner CPU on the
SLG board and drives carriage-1 and -2.
The scan motor is driven by the pulse signal (SCNM-A, SCNM-AB, SCNM-B, SCNM-BB) output from
the motor driver. These pulse signals are formed based on the reference clock (MOTCLK) and output
only when the enable signal (MOTEN) is a high level. Also, the rotation speed or direction of the motor
can be switched by changing the output timing of each pulse signal.
